Well, the linear equation can be expressed as y=ax+b in the solution of linear equations, there 3 main cases can be concluded as final lines. 1st case - the linear equation has no solution (for example, 0*x=5 has no solutions). 2nd case - the linear equation has one solution (for example 4*x=3 where the only one solution is x=0.75) and the 3rd case - the linear equation has infinite number of solutions (for example 0*x=0). In order to find the perimeter, we need to have the length and the width. We are told that the area of the rectangle is 42. We will use that in the area formula, length times width, to solve for w. 42 = 7w so w = 6. The length is 7 and the width is 6. The perimeter formula for a rectangle is P = 2L + 2W. We have both the length and the width now, so we fill in accordingly. P = 2(7) + 2(6). And P=14+12. The perimeter then is 26 inches.
